Here is a guided meditation for cultivating compassion in thoughts words & deeds.
Take a few moments to ease in and breathe genttly in a quiet space.
In awareness calmly sense the natural rhythm of your own breath.
Think of someone you know who is kind and imagine the warmth that radiates from your heart towards them and extend the very same energy to someone who is challenged by it.
In every inhale, welcome peace in silence and likewise in every exhale release the unnecessary. Inhale faith and exhale doubt.
Every positive compassion filled thought reshaped the internal narrative and the world around us.
Sense the moments integrating in empathy in compassionate connection & possibility.
Incorporating such conscious and intentional practices embodies compassion into our spheres of influence in and around us through thoughts, words & deeds
